The big bad wolf is a classic antagonist in many children's stories. In the story of the three little pigs, the wolf represents the force of evil and destruction. He is lazy as he doesn't want to build his own house and instead tries to take over the pigs' houses. His attempts to blow down the houses made of straw and sticks show his aggression. However, the pigs' resourcefulness and the strength of the brick house ultimately lead to his downfall. This story has been told for generations to teach kids values like hard work and smart thinking.
